Hamas Urges Mediators to Pressure Israel to Reopen Rafah Crossing

A senior Hamas official reaffirmed the ​group’s commitment to the initial phase of the Gaza ceasefire agreement and urged mediators to pressure Israel into ⁢reopening the Rafah crossing.

According to⁣ the English section of webangah News ‍Agency, ​quoting Mehr News Agency, Muhammad Nazzal, a leader ⁤of the Islamic Resistance Movement⁣ Hamas, ‌told Al Jazeera Mubasher that Hamas remains committed‌ to implementing provisions related to returning live Israeli captives and handing over recovered bodies.He stated, “We are committed to delivering live captives and what we have obtained of ‌Israeli prisoners’ bodies.”

Nazzal emphasized that Hamas opposes holding Palestinians hostage⁣ by closing the⁤ Rafah crossing. He called on mediators to pressure the israeli ‌occupation regime into opening Rafah in⁣ accordance with the terms of the agreement.

He added that while Hamas is willing to‌ move flexibly into the second phase after fulfilling commitments in phase one, negotiations for this next stage have ​not yet begun. Nazzal blamed Netanyahu’s obstinance for this ⁣delay.

Nazzal also ⁤highlighted the urgent need for heavy equipment and specialized⁢ technical teams to recover bodies⁢ trapped under‍ rubble. He said Hamas has submitted a list⁤ of more than ‌40 autonomous national figures from which a‍ committee of technocrats can be selected to manage Gaza’s affairs.
